Jan has a 12 ounce milkshake. 4 ounces are vanilla, the rest is chocolate. What are 2 equivalent fractions that represent the fraction of the milkshake that is vanilla?

If there are 4 ounces of vanilla in a 12 ounces milkshake , it means that every 3 ounces of milkshake , 1 ounce of those 3 ounces is vanilla 4 ÷ 12 = 1/3
1/3 is the proportion of vanilla and milkshake.

4 ÷ 12 can also be written as 2/6 or 4/12

Awnser : 1/3 , 2/6 or 4/12 , 8/24 etc ...
